Mô tả

​UPDATE JUNE 2022:

  • ​ESPIDF BLE Code Compatibility Version Update

Hello learners!

Welcome to MAKERDEMY's “Introduction to BLE” course.

This is a beginner level course that will teach all there is to know about BLE and BLE Mesh. We will be using the most popular IoT board called the ESP32 to explore the BLE features, implementations and projects. This course is one stop destination for beginners to understand BLE in-depth and implement projects.

This course will strengthen your knowledge on the fundamental concepts pertaining to BLE and BLE Mesh and will give you hands-on experience in implementing end-to-end projects with the ESP32. You will be very confident with the BLE concepts, architecture, features, how to implement them and the security process. You will become confident to integrate BLE and MESH features into your own projects using ESP IDF and Visual Studio Code. Finally, you will implement a full fledged BLE Mesh enabled Capstone project that combines the learnings and features learned throughout the course

If you complete all sections in the course, and the course assignments, you will confidently be able to develop and work on implementing your own BLE solutions.

Throughout the course, we have provided a curated collection of original resources. These resources include links to documents for in-depth learning, links, videos, and more. At MAKERDEMY, we have a dedicated instructor team who will promptly answer any of your course-related queries.

So, what are you waiting for?! Come, join me in this course. I’m looking forward to being your instructor and to give you an introduction into the world of Bluetooth Low Energy.


Bạn sẽ học được gì

Learn in-depth all the concepts related to BLE & BLE Mesh

In-depth technical primer into BLE covering its architecture, features, core concepts and security process

Explore the BLE Mesh concepts in detail covering its architecture, features, core concepts and security process

Get hands on experience in basic BLE features using the ESP32 board and ESP-IDF

In-depth hands on section with all core features of ESP BLE MESH and implemented them

Complete a BLE Mesh enabled Capstone project

Yêu cầu

  • A basic understanding of electronics and related concepts
  • A basic experience of working with ESP32 on Arduino
  • Recommended to have a basic knowledge of C and C++ programming languages

Nội dung khoá học

6 sections

Bluetooth Low Energy Fundamentals

6 lectures
Introduction to the course
05:14
What is Bluetooth Low Energy?
05:59
Advantages and Limitations of BLE
04:22
Real World Applications of BLE
06:42
Role of BLE in the Wireless Domain
04:12
Assignment 1
4 questions

In-depth Technical Primer into BLE

11 lectures
Overall Architecture of BLE
03:40
Application, Host, and Controller
05:59
Understanding the BLE Stack
05:06
BLE Peripherals and Central
03:16
Advertising and Scanning in BLE
07:14
Connections in BLE
05:42
Characteristics, Profiles, and Attributes in BLE
05:09
Security in BLE Part 1: Pairing and Bonding
06:09
Security in BLE Part 2: Security Keys, Modes and Levels
02:49
How to design a BLE GATT?
03:59
Assignment 2
5 questions

Introduction to BLE Mesh

6 lectures
What is BLE Mesh?
06:50
Fundamental Architecture of BLE Mesh
03:00
BLE Mesh Core Concepts
04:56
BLE Mesh Provisioning Process
03:59
Security in BLE Mesh
04:24
Assignment 3
4 questions

Getting Started with BLE using ESP32

9 lectures
Why use ESP32?
04:23
What you can and can’t do with ESP32?
03:06
ESPIDF BLE Code Compatibility Version Update
00:31
Installing and Configuring ESP IDF
06:34
BLE GATT Server & Client Implementation in ESP32
05:48
BLE Secure GATT Server and Client Implementation in ESP32
06:26
BLE Throughput Measuring Implementation using ESP32
03:19
BLE HID Implementation using ESP32
05:57
Assignment 4
10 questions

Getting Started with BLE MESH using ESP32

6 lectures
BLE MESH capabilities in ESP32
04:57
BLE MESH Node, Provisioner & Console Implementation
05:03
BLE MESH Fast Provisioner Implementation
04:30
BLE MESH Sensor and Vendor Model Implementation
05:35
BLE MESH Wi-Fi Coexistence Implementation
05:06
Assignment 5
4 questions

Capstone BLE Project using ESP32

6 lectures
BLE Mesh Notice Board for Hotels Part 1: Architecture Overview
03:41
BLE Mesh Notice Board for Hotels Part 2: Interfacing and Configurations
04:04
BLE Mesh Notice Board for Hotels Part 3: Coding
04:23
BLE Mesh Notice Board for Hotels Part 4: Implementation
02:54
Further Learnings
04:47
Assignment 6
2 questions

Đánh giá của học viên

Chưa có đánh giá
Course Rating
5
0%
4
0%
3
0%
2
0%
1
0%

Bình luận khách hàng

Viết Bình Luận

Bạn đánh giá khoá học này thế nào?

image

Đăng ký get khoá học Udemy - Unica - Gitiho giá chỉ 50k!

Get khoá học giá rẻ ngay trước khi bị fix.